gpt4 book ai didi

javascript - 在客户端调试 Javascript

转载 作者:行者123 更新时间:2023-11-28 13:45:35 25 4
gpt4 key购买 nike

我是一个 JS 菜鸟,希望成为一个 JS 怪物,这意味着大量的调试。

我正在使用 Chrome 调试器工具。在我面前,有一大堆意大利面条式的 JS 代码,看起来就像需要破译的达芬奇代码。我需要对此进行调试并了解正在发生的事情。本质上,我想找出 .js 文件中的哪个函数在特定事件上被调用。为此,我设置了“事件监听器断点”来记录任何鼠标单击事件。当我点击相关按钮时,我得到的是:

Debugging the client side click

正如您所看到的,调试器确实停止了即将在这轮事件中执行的相应 jQuery 函数上的脚本。不幸的是,这对于所有基于 jQuery 的函数来说都是非常通用的,并且没有多大帮助。我真正感兴趣的是我的 JS 文件中触发 jQuery 函数的函数,而不是 jQuery 库中调用的函数。

插图:

$('#myButton').live('click', function(){
$('#popUpMenu').close();
});

这是调试浏览器事件的正确方法吗?如果这还不够清楚,请让我详细说明。

最佳答案

您可以从美化 JavaScript 代码开始:

enter image description here

关于javascript - 在客户端调试 Javascript,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14653711/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com